4 Tips to Select a Portable Air Conditioner: Benefits and Drawbacks

1. Understand the BTU Rating

The British Thermal Unit (BTU) measures the cooling power of an air conditioner. A higher BTU rating indicates a more powerful unit suitable for larger spaces. Here's a quick reference guide to help you:

  • 100-200 sq ft: 5,000 - 6,000 BTU
  • 200-400 sq ft: 7,000 - 10,000 BTU
  • 400-800 sq ft: 10,000 - 14,000 BTU

Selecting the correct BTU ensures effective cooling while avoiding energy waste. Be cautious, as an excessively high BTU for a small area can lead to increased humidity and less efficiency.

2. Check Energy Efficiency

It's important to look at the Energy Efficiency Ratio (EER) of the air conditioning units. The EER signifies the ratio of the cooling capacity to the power input. A higher EER indicates improved energy efficiency.

For instance, an air conditioner with a cooling capacity of 10,000 BTU consuming 1,200 watts would have an EER of around 8.33. Aim for models with an EER of 10 or above to maximize savings on your energy bills.

3. Consider Portability Features

Although "portable" suggests ease of movement, not all models deliver the same level of mobility. Look for the following features:

  • Lightweight construction for easy relocation between rooms.
  • Integrated wheels for simple transport.
  • Flexible exhaust hoses suitable for various window types.

These features can enhance your experience and allow effortless relocation of the unit to whichever room you're currently using.

4. Analyze Noise Levels

Portable air conditioners can sometimes be noisy. Therefore, it's advisable to check the decibel (dB) rating before finalizing your purchase. Here's a quick guide on noise levels:

  • Quiet: 40-50 dB (whispering)
  • Moderate: 50-60 dB (normal conversation)
  • Loud: 60 dB and above (high noise levels)

For bedrooms and other peaceful environments, opt for models that operate at 50 dB or lower to ensure comfort.

Benefits and Drawbacks

Portable air conditioners offer several conveniences but also have their share of pros and cons:

Benefits

  • Simple installation and convenient mobility between rooms.
  • No need for permanent installation.
  • Ability to provide targeted cooling to specific areas.

Drawbacks

  • May not be as effective as central air conditioning systems.
  • Often louder than window air conditioning units.
  • Some models may incur higher long-term operating costs.
